Water Cooled Refrigeration Efficiency Issue
To: A54 owners and others that have seawater heat exchange for refrigeration Recently an A54 owner found his refrigeration efficiency problem was caused by an 80% blockage in the Primary Saltwater Manifold. This was not easily seen from the Sea Chest, and really can only be seen by removing the 35mm Hose to the Secondary Manifold. After doing all sorts of things to increase efficiency, he discovered that he had erroneously omitted a checking for a clogged Primary Saltwater Manifold and the Hose connecting the Primary to the Secondary Saltwater Manifold. What was happening was since the Primary Saltwater Manifold blockage was on the suction side of both Refrigeration and AC Pumps, the AC pump being much stronger simply starved the Refrigeration Pump. The same is true of the Saltwater Pumps on the Onan and the Main Engine. If there is a restriction in the supply line the Refrigeration Pump will be starved for water and your fridge and freezer will suffer.
